«Zhamanak». Kocharian's 'Supporters' for a Million: New Activists Being Sought
«Zhamanak» newspaper reports: Former President Robert Kocharian, charged in the March 1 case, has regularized the payment of activists. According to information we have received, each group leader is paid half a million drams a month. The group leader is responsible for ensuring the participation of activists during demonstrations. After each event, participants receive their due payments.
We have learned that office managers and previously recognized political figures supporting Kocharian receive even larger sums. The money is distributed by Armen Tavadyan, while the actions of the activists are organized personally by Kocharian's son, Levon Kocharian, and his son-in-law, Vigen Chatinyan.
Sources tell us that, following the resumption of the trial, Kocharian's team is actively engaged in searching for new activists. They understand that the trial will be prolonged and that those shouting 'hero' outside the courthouse won't last long.
Interestingly, despite the Prime Minister's spokesperson stating that Kocharian is being supported financially, the National Security Service has yet to disclose any evidence of such large sums in circulation.
